Frequently Asked Questions
What is the ICD-10 code for methicillin suscep staph infct causing dis classd elswhr?
The ICD-10-CM code for methicillin suscep staph infct causing dis classd elswhr is B95.61. The full clinical description is "Methicillin susceptible Staphylococcus aureus infection as the cause of diseases classified elsewhere". B95.61 is a billable/specific code that can be used on insurance claims and medical billing.
What does ICD-10 code B95.61 mean?
ICD-10-CM code B95.61 represents “Methicillin susceptible Staphylococcus aureus infection as the cause of diseases classified elsewhere”. It is classified under Chapter 1: Certain Infectious and Parasitic Diseases and is a billable/specific code that can be used on a claim.
Is B95.61 a billable code?
Yes, B95.61 is a billable/specific ICD-10-CM code and can be used to indicate a diagnosis on a medical claim.
What chapter is B95.61 in?
B95.61 is in Chapter 1: Certain Infectious and Parasitic Diseases (codes A00-B99).
What codes cannot be used with B95.61?
B95.61 has Excludes1 notes indicating codes that cannot be used together with it, including: certain localized infections - see body system-related chapters.
Are additional codes required with B95.61?
Yes, when using B95.61, also report: resistance to antimicrobial drugs (Z16.-).
